Navigating the Marketplace for SEO: Finding the Right Solutions for Your Business! In today’s competitive digital landscape, the need for effective SEO has created a booming marketplace filled with diverse service providers and tools. From full-service SEO agencies delivering end-to-end optimization strategies to specialized freelancers and robust software platforms, businesses have no shortage of options. Navigating this landscape can be overwhelming, but choosing the right SEO solution is crucial for increasing visibility, driving organic traffic, and achieving long-term growth online.
Types of SEO Services Available
1. Full-Service SEO Agencies
These agencies offer end-to-end SEO solutions, including keyword research, on-page optimization, content creation, link building, and performance reporting. Ideal for businesses looking for a hands-off, comprehensive strategy, full-service agencies are equipped to handle SEO for companies of all sizes and industries.
2. Specialized SEO Agencies
Some agencies focus on niche areas of SEO, such as:
Technical SEO: Optimizing site speed, crawlability, mobile usability, etc.
Local SEO: Helping businesses rank in local map packs and location-based searches.
E-commerce SEO: Tailoring strategies for online stores and product optimization.
Specialized agencies are great for businesses with targeted needs or existing SEO efforts that need refinement.
3. Freelancers and Independent Consultants
Freelancers typically offer more flexible, cost-effective SEO services on a per-project or hourly basis. They may focus on a particular aspect of SEO such as:
Website audits
Content strategy
Link building campaigns
This option works well for startups, small businesses, or companies needing support in specific areas.
4. SEO Tools and Software
Beyond service providers, the market also includes powerful SEO tools that allow businesses to manage SEO in-house. Common features include:
Keyword tracking
Site audits
Backlink analysis
Competitor insights
Performance dashboards
Top platforms like SEMrush, Ahrefs, and Moz help automate and scale SEO efforts with robust data.
Key Factors to Consider When Choosing an SEO Solution
Business Objectives
What are you aiming to achieve—higher rankings, more traffic, better leads? Clarifying your goals helps determine whether you need a full-service partner, a niche specialist, or DIY tools.
Budget & Internal Resources
Full-service agencies offer the most support but come at a premium. Smaller businesses may find more value in working with consultants or leveraging tools in-house, depending on internal capabilities.
Experience & Credibility
Look for SEO providers with proven success in your industry. Case studies, testimonials, and transparent reporting are key indicators of quality.
Scalability & Flexibility
Choose a solution that can grow with your business. As your SEO needs evolve, your provider or tool should be able to adapt and continue delivering value.
Analytics & Reporting
Effective SEO requires measurement. Prioritize solutions that offer in-depth reporting so you can track ROI and adjust strategies accordingly.
Tips for Making the Right Choice
Research and Compare Options: Explore reviews, case studies, and third-party evaluations to narrow down your shortlist.
Request Demos and Proposals: Engage directly with providers to see their offerings in action. Ask questions specific to your goals.
Get Peer Recommendations: Reach out to business peers or communities for real-world insights on SEO partners they trust.
